I received confirmation from a plugged-in SHL fan that Alsing's contract agreement includes the caveat that he won't be leaving his SHL team in the first year and will be coming to North America in the 2nd year. I suppose he would come this year if he was going to be on the NHL roster but that doesn't seem likely and it's doubtful he is even at camp this Fall because the SHL season starts earlier.

In any case, I wouldn't be including him in any Belleville lineups for this season.

Seven goalies playing pro this season [Anderson, Nilsson, Condon, Hogberg, Daccord, Gustavsson, Dubeau] and two more in Canadian junior [Sogaard and Mandolese].

Dubeau is not technically an Ottawa Senators player, but regardless. It's a lot.

Dubeau is an interesting signing. Just turned 25, he had fairly pedestrian numbers in 5 years in the QMJHL, but last year a 0.78 GAA and .957 SV% playing for UNB in the atlantic playoffs, and then a 1.33 GAA and .948 SV% to win the Usports championship, as well as tournament MVP.

Followed that up with a .921 SV% in 6 games in the ECHL to start his pro career.

Probably won't ever amount to anything in the NHL, but who knows, goalies are weird.
